Best Places to Visit in Portland: Food, Adventure & Day Trips Worth the Hype
Portland isn’t just another city—it’s a vibrant playground for every kind of explorer. Whether you’re a food lover, an adventure seeker, or planning a family day out, Portland’s got you covered. Let’s dive into some of the city’s most buzzworthy spots that truly live up to the hype.
đ˝ď¸ For the Foodies
- Washington Park – Not just for nature buffs! Around the park’s edges, you’ll stumble upon cozy cafés and quirky food carts. After a scenic hike or garden stroll, grab a gourmet sandwich or a steaming bowl of noodles and settle in for a picnic with a postcard view. Explore More
- Portland Spirit Office & Caruthers Landing Dock – Imagine dining as the city skyline drifts by. The Portland Spirit offers river cruises with delicious meals, perfect for romantic evenings or memorable group gatherings. Details Here
đď¸ For the Adventurers
- Sea to Summit Tours & Adventures – Want to see Mt. Hood, sip wine in the valley, or dip your toes in the Pacific? These guided tours take the hassle out of planning and let you experience Portland’s wild side, whether you’re a visitor or a local craving a new adventure. See Tours
- Hoyt Arboretum – Wander through 12 miles of trails in this living tree museum. Every season brings a new color palette, making it a magical spot for peaceful hikes and nature photography. Plan Your Visit
đž For Families & Nature Lovers
- Oregon Zoo – A timeless Portland favorite! The zoo’s lush, leafy grounds and conservation-focused exhibits make it fun and educational for all ages. Visit the zoo
- Pittock Mansion – Step back in time at this historic home perched high above the city. The gardens, architecture, and sweeping views offer a perfect blend of culture and nature. It’s a must for history buffs and anyone who loves a good photo op.
- Ole Bolle Troll – Nestled in the woods, this whimsical sculpture delights kids and adults alike. It’s the ultimate spot for playful adventures and those can’t-miss Instagram photos. Learn more
- The Grotto – Escape to this peaceful sanctuary, where lush botanical gardens and stunning cliffside views invite quiet reflection. It’s the perfect place for a serene stroll or a moment of calm in the city. Discover more
